What Makes Rowing Inspirational is a motivational short film made by BentleyNuts.. We followed the Bath University's 1st Novice Boat at BUCS 2012 (Nottingham). This video contains the build up and the actual race with onboard cameras to get right in with the action!
The boat was the Novice men 1st Boat - Rowing at BUCS
What I was trying to portray in this video was the preparation, anticipation and the thrill you get from rowing in competition.
